Mary Angela Baker, M.A., Principal Consultant, Firm Fortitude

Mary Angela Baker’s vocation is to create opportunities where women and girls can step into their leadership and thrive. Currently, she is the principal consultant at Firm Fortitude. She has an extensive career in higher education, focusing on leadership and professional development, continuing education, outreach, and community engagement. She was the founding director of the Center for Extended and Lifelong Learning at Salisbury University in Maryland. Prior to this, Baker was the director of the Leadership Institute at St. Catherine University. Located in St. Paul, Minnesota, “St. Kate’s” is one of the largest women’s colleges in the United States. Baker has created several leadership programs for girls and women at all career and life stages. Baker is currently active in several women’s leadership initiatives; she is a founding leadership team member of the University of Minnesota’s Carlson Women Global Connect, a founding member of the United Way of the Eastern Shore’s Women United, and on the executive leadership team for the International Leadership Association’s Women & Leadership member community. A lifelong learner, Baker is a Feminist Leadership Fellow from the University of Minnesota and an alumna of Leadership Maryland. She received her undergraduate degree in business administration from the University of Minnesota and a master’s degree in organizational leadership from St. Catherine University.
